The Superiority of Standing Seam Roofing

Not all metal roofs are created equal. If you want the absolute best in modern design and weatherproofing, our premium Standing Seam Roofing is the ultimate choice. This specialized system features raised interlocking seams that run vertically along the metal panels.

Because the fasteners are completely hidden and protected under the seams, this design eliminates the risk of leaks caused by exposed screws over time. It gives your home or business a sleek, contemporary architectural look while maximizing defense against heavy rainfall and severe hail damage. Frequently Asked Questions About Lubbock Metal Roofing

1. How much does a new metal roof cost in Lubbock, TX?

The cost of installing a new metal roof depends on the size, pitch, and complexity of your home. Generally, a standard corrugated or steel panel roof ranges from $6 to $9 per square foot, while a premium Standing Seam Roofing system can cost between $9 to $12 per square foot installed. While the upfront investment for lubbock metal roofing is higher than asphalt shingles, it lasts 2 to 3 times longer, saving you massive replacement costs in the long run.

2. Can a metal roof withstand severe West Texas hail and high winds?

Yes, absolutely. High-quality lubbock metal roofing systems carry an industry-leading Class 4 hail resistance rating, meaning they can easily withstand up to 2.5-inch hailstones with only minor cosmetic impacts. Additionally, our commercial-grade metal panels are engineered with a 140-mph wind uplift rating, making them highly resilient against the relentless 70mph winds and intense dust storms typical of the Texas Panhandle.

3. Are metal roofs noisy when it rains or during Texas storm seasons?

This is a common misconception built from older barns or sheds. For modern residential homes, we install heavy-duty solid sheathing, advanced underlayments, and dense attic insulation beneath the metal roof. These layers absorb vibration and deaden acoustic resonance completely. As a result, a professionally installed lubbock metal roofing system is just as quiet as traditional asphalt shingles during heavy rainstorms.

4. Do metal roofs attract heat and increase summer cooling bills?

On the contrary, a high-performance metal roof is incredibly energy-efficient. Modern painted metal panels incorporate highly reflective cool-roof pigments that reflect up to 70% to 90% of solar radiant energy. Instead of absorbing heat like dark asphalt shingles, it releases heat rapidly, reducing your home's air conditioning energy costs by as much as 20% to 40% during scorching Texas summers.

5. Can you install a new metal roof over my existing asphalt shingles?

In most cases, yes! One of the major structural advantages of lightweight steel panels is that they can be directly retrofitted over an existing single-layer asphalt shingle roof. This eliminates messy tear-off labor costs and prevents thousands of pounds of old roofing debris from ending up in local Texas landfills. 6. Does installing a permanent metal roof lower my homeowner insurance premiums?

Yes, it frequently does. Because a premium metal roof provides superior fire resistance (Class A fire rating), exceptional wind durability, and Class 4 impact resistance against hail damage, many major insurance providers in Texas offer premium discounts of up to 25% to 35% for homes with permanent metal structures.
